This paper clarifies the apparent randomness and confusion in the choice of different query methods using LSI to be found in the current text and image retrieval literature. We also propose and test some modified query approaches using the novel technique of singular value rescaling (SVR). Experiments on standardized TREC data set confirmed the effectiveness of SVR, showing an improvement ratio of 5.6% over the best conventional LSI query approach. © Springer-Verlag Berlin Heidelberg 2005.
